Characteristics and advantages of tinplate cans
1 opaque
In addition to causing food spoilage reactions, light can also cause changes in proteins and oxyacids. Vitamin C is more likely to interact with other food ingredients when exposed to light, resulting in a large amount of loss. According to research and analysis data, the loss of vitamin C in milk in transparent glass bottles is 12 times higher than that in dark bottles. Light will cause oxidative odor in milk, as well as the cracking of nuclides and methionine, which will lose nutritional value. The light-tightness of the can makes the preservation rate of vitamin C the highest.
2. Good sealing
The barrier of the packaging container to air and other volatile gases is very important for the preservation of nutrients and sensory quality. Comparison of various fruit juice packaging containers proves that the oxygen permeability of the container directly affects the preservation of vitamin C of the juice; the oxygen permeability Low metal containers and glass bottles are good for vitamin C, and iron cans are the best. .
3. Reduction of tin
Tin on the inner wall of tinplate will interact with the oxygen remaining in the container during filling, reducing the chance of food ingredients being oxidized. The reduction effect of tin has a good preservation effect on the flavor and color of light-colored fruits and juices. Therefore, the juice of unpainted iron cans is better in nutrient preservation than the juice of other packaging materials, the brown color changes slightly, and the flavor quality Acceptability is good, the storage period is extended
4. Provide a source of effective iron
Tinplate canned foods, except for a few light-colored fruits and juice cans, mostly use internally painted empty cans to improve the tolerance characteristics of passengers: due to the electrochemical effect of metals, painted canned canned foods will have a small amount in storage The dissolved iron is present in the form of ferrous iron in the sealed canned food, which is easily absorbed by the human body and its content is about 1 to 10 ppm. As far as fruit and vegetable products are concerned, the raw material itself does not contain much iron. Iron can products are calculated in 350 ml beverage cans per can, with an iron content of 5 ppmi. Each can provides 1.75 mg of iron, which is about 18 mg of the daily intake of the body one tenth. If the above-mentioned fruit and vegetable juice beverages are rich in vitamin C, iron is more easily absorbed, so iron canned foods and beverages can be a good source of iron elements, and it has a more profound significance for the nutrition of iron cans.
